Most of the information required In Part I and all of the Information required In Part II of Form R can be filled In and photocopied and attached to each chemical-specific report. Part I must have an original signature on the certification statement and the trade secret designation must be entered as appropriate. You have the option to complete Part II for only the off-site locations that apply to the Individual chemical cited In the report g you can list all off-site locations that apply to all chemicals being reported and Include a photostatic copy of this Part II with each individual report. Part III must be completed separately for each chemical. Part IV provides additional space, if needed, to complete the information required by the preceding sections of the form. Include Part IV In your report, even it it Is blank. [Pg.20]

Production records must be completed in ink, preferably black or blue ink. Records should be completed in conjunction with the completion of each step. Records should never be completed before the task has been performed nor should tasks be completed with the entries made to the record at a later time. A space for an entry on a record should never be left blank. All notations expected on the production record must be either completed or the record should indicate why no entry was necessary. Completed production records should be reviewed by a supervisor to ensure that the record is complete with no blank spaces and that appropriate entries have been made. The supervisor acknowledges his/her review by signature or initials and date. [Pg.376]

The same sample is again heated to the original temperature for the same holding time, and the measurement procedure is repeated. For inclusion-free samples, this re-extracf step will yield He at levels indistinguishable from that of the preceding hot blank. However, a substantial amount of He in this step has been found to be the telltale signature of mineral inclusions, at least in the case of apatite. If such He is found, the analysis is rejected as likely to be compromised by inclusions. [Pg.844]

Prescriptions for controlled substances should be dated and signed on the day of their issuance and must bear the full name and address of the patient and the printed name, address, and DEA number of the practitioner they should be signed as one would sign a legal document. Preprinted orders are not allowed in most states, and presigned blanks are prohibited by federal law. When oral orders are not permitted (schedule 11), the prescription must be written with ink or typewritten. The order may be prepared by a member of the physician s staff, but the prescriber is responsible for the signature and any errors that the order may contain. [Pg.1146]
